#4d69e2 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#4d69e2 is composed of 30.2% red, 41.2% green and 88.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 65.9% cyan, 53.5% magenta, 0% yellow and 11.4% black. It has a hue angle of 228.7 degrees, a saturation of 72% and a lightness of 59.4%. #4d69e2 color hex could be obtained by blending #9ad2ff with #0000c5. Closest websafe color is: #6666cc.

Shades and Tints of #4d69e2
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010208 is the darkest color, while #f6f7fd is the lightest one.

Tones of #4d69e2
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#95969a is the less saturated color, while #355afa is the most saturated one.
